From London City Psychotherapy: Between January 1943 and May 1944, the British Psychoanalytic Society held ten meetings to resolve major disagreements over the theory, practice, and teaching of psychoanalysis. A new documentary has been released about this reportedly acrimonious period in the history of psychoanalysis.
